What is the primary purpose of RF shielding in electronic equipment?

Explanation:
The primary purpose of RF shielding in electronic equipment is to prevent electromagnetic interference (EMI). This interference can negatively affect the performance of electronic devices by causing unwanted noise, signal distortion, or even complete signal loss. RF shielding helps contain and block unwanted radio frequency signals from entering or exiting a device, thereby protecting sensitive circuit components from external noise sources. By employing materials that can reflect or absorb radio waves, RF shielding ensures that the device operates reliably and as intended. This is particularly important in environments where multiple electronic devices may be operating simultaneously, as the potential for interference increases. Effective shielding can lead to clearer signals and improved device functionality, making it a crucial aspect of modern electronic design.
